Output d3225fd8c61a116f3b9afdcb72a41f71513bd3d095beae1e0db889ab860d8709:1

value
43143300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f53175d0372d02b6cceaeb97db93fda7b0e157e0 OP_EQUAL
address
MWFd2z2z4b5s5p7QhPKQtZxT2fpNC1JrsT
transaction
d3225fd8c61a116f3b9afdcb72a41f71513bd3d095beae1e0db889ab860d8709
spent
true